In addition, the company is continuing negotiations with the Port of Miami-Dade and Porto Cancun in Cancun, Mexico. The company is in the process of providing requested data regarding the project to these entities in order to facilitate the consummation of a long-term lease and the establishment of locales for the first UnderSea Resorts.
